3. Choose The Accommodation Wisely

One often fantasizes about traveling and living in RVs and campervans. The cost of it all including the food and fuel makes both the options pretty costly. Since one has to park their automobiles, the high parking rates also get stacked and make it more costly than expected. 
The best way to save some moolah is to look for local accommodation options. Accommodation houses in town are much cheaper as well as the availability of an actual kitchen gives one the liberty of cooking their own food, thus reducing the dining costs!

4. Advanced Booking

One can get really cheap and good deals if the accommodation registration is done in advance. The best way would be to plan and chart the budget trip and look for places that fit your budget. Booking in advance would probably even get you lower-priced accommodations. 
Some accommodations like motels and private lodgings are generally cheaper than RV’s and it also gives one comfortable accommodation instead of a backpacker feel. 

5. Consider The Youth Hostel Association

Each of the YHA locations in New Zealand has incredibly scenic views. The accommodation is cheaper as well as aesthetic. One can even come across various types of travelers like families, solo ones, and couples staying in the YHA.
Purchasing a membership for the YHA would get you a 10% discount as well!

5. Where To Stay While Hiking?

The Department Of Conservation is the government body that manages many public lands of New Zealand and various parks come under them. It is the best accommodation option for those who wish to climb mountains and hike on their visit to New Zealand. 
The DOC provides huts that can accommodate groups of people at a small fee. The huts also consist of stoves and comfy mattress for a makeshift place to spend the night. 

6. Get A Backcountry Hut Pass For Groups 

If one considers staying in the hut but has a lot of people in their group, the best option is to get the Backcountry pass. These passes come with 6 months or 12 months duration facility providing the occupants of as many huts as required by the group. 
They also provide discounts, and if one has the YHA membership they can avail their discount here as well.
